To establish the safety and effectiveness of the Edwards PASCAL Transcatheter Valve Repair System in patients with degenerative mitral regurgitation (DMR) who have been determined to be at prohibitive risk for mitral valve surgery by the Heart Team, and in patients with functional mitral regurgitation (FMR) on guideline directed medical therapy (GDMT)
A prospective, multicenter, randomized, controlled pivotal trial to evaluate the safety and effectiveness of transcatheter mitral valve repair with the Edwards PASCAL Transcatheter Valve Repair System compared to Abbott MitraClip in patients with degenerative mitral regurgitation (DMR) who have been determined to be at prohibitive risk for mitral valve surgery by the Heart Team, and in patients with functional mitral regurgitation (FMR) on guideline directed medical therapy (GDMT)
Patients will be seen for follow-up visits at discharge, 30 days, 6 months, and annually through 5 years.

| Measure | Description | Time Frame |
|---|---|---|
| PASCAL is not inferior to MitraClip with respect to the proportion of patients with major adverse events (MAE). The primary safety endpoint is a composite of Major Adverse Events (MAEs). | 30 days. | |
| PASCAL is not inferior to Mitraclip with respect to the proportion of patients with MR severity reduction as measured by echocardiography using a scale of 0-4+ for the CLASP IID Cohort. | 6 months | |
| PASCAL is not inferior to Mitraclip with respect to the time to first heart failure hospitalization or death for the CLASP IIF Cohort only. | From date of randomization until date of first heart failure hospitalization or death, through 5 year follow-up |
